891 FNUS55 KPUB 230520 FWFPUB Fire Weather Planning Forecast FOR S Cntrl and Sern Colorado National Weather Service Pueblo Co 1120 PM MDT Sat Jun 22 2019 .Discussion... Thunderstorms will gradually diminish across the district overnight, while rain and high mountain snow showers continue as an unseasonably strong storm system moves across the state. Sunday will see some lingering showers and thunderstorms across the eastern half of the district as the storm system pulls away. Then drier and warmer weather spreads in through next week with at least isolated thunderstorms possible each day over the mountains. Afternoon smoke dispersion will rise into the good to very good categories across the plains, with excellent dispersion across the mountains on Sunday.
